首页 » 排名链接 » C语言库管理,构建高效软件开发的基石

C语言库管理,构建高效软件开发的基石

duote123 2024-12-28 00:54:45 0

扫一扫用手机浏览

文章目录 [+]

在计算机科学领域,C语言作为一种历史悠久、应用广泛的编程语言,为众多软件开发提供了坚实的基础。随着软件项目的复杂性不断提高,C语言库管理在软件开发过程中扮演着至关重要的角色。本文将从C语言库管理的概念、重要性、分类、应用等方面进行探讨,以期为软件开发者提供有益的启示。

一、C语言库管理概述

1. 概念

C语言库管理,即对C语言函数库进行有效组织、管理和维护的过程。函数库是一组具有特定功能的函数集合,用于简化软件开发过程中的编程任务。C语言库管理旨在提高软件开发效率、降低开发成本、保证软件质量。

2. 重要性

(1)提高开发效率:通过使用C语言库,开发者可以避免重复编写相同的代码,从而提高开发效率。

(2)降低开发成本:库中的函数已经过优化,可以减少开发过程中的调试和修改工作,降低开发成本。

(3)保证软件质量:经过严格测试和验证的库函数,可以保证软件质量。

二、C语言库分类

1. 标准库

标准库是C语言的基础库,主要包括输入输出、字符串处理、数学计算、数据结构等函数。标准库在C语言编译器中自带,开发者可以直接使用。

2. 扩展库

扩展库是针对特定需求开发的库,如图形处理、网络通信、数据库操作等。扩展库通常由第三方组织或个人提供,开发者可根据需求选择合适的库。

3. 系统库

系统库是操作系统提供的库,如Windows API、Linux系统调用等。系统库为开发者提供了丰富的操作系统功能,如进程管理、内存管理、文件操作等。

三、C语言库管理应用

1. 开发工具

C语言库管理在开发工具中具有重要应用,如集成开发环境(IDE)、代码编辑器等。这些工具通常内置了丰富的C语言库,方便开发者快速查找和调用所需函数。

2. 软件开发

在软件开发过程中,C语言库管理有助于提高开发效率、降低开发成本、保证软件质量。开发者可选用合适的库,以满足项目需求。

3. 教育培训

C语言库管理是计算机科学教育的重要组成部分。通过学习C语言库,学生可以掌握软件开发的基本技能,为今后从事相关工作奠定基础。

C语言库管理在软件开发过程中具有举足轻重的地位。通过对C语言库的有效组织、管理和维护,可以提高开发效率、降低开发成本、保证软件质量。随着软件工程的不断发展,C语言库管理将更加重要,为我国软件产业的发展贡献力量。

(注:本文部分内容引用了《C程序设计语言》(第2版)等权威资料,以增强说服力。)

标签:

相关文章

IT周末郑州,一场科技盛宴的启幕

随着信息技术的飞速发展,我国在科技领域取得了举世瞩目的成就。郑州,这座古老而又充满活力的城市,近年来在信息技术领域的发展势头迅猛。...

排名链接 2024-12-28 阅读1 评论0

ITUP服装,引领时尚潮流的先锋品牌

在当今社会,服装已经成为人们生活的重要组成部分。随着人们生活水平的提高,对于服装的需求也越来越高。ITUP服装作为国内知名品牌,以...

排名链接 2024-12-28 阅读1 评论0

R语言cov函数,探索多元数据间的相关性

在数据统计分析中,了解数据之间的相关性至关重要。R语言作为一种功能强大的统计分析软件,提供了丰富的函数供用户使用。其中,cov函数...

排名链接 2024-12-28 阅读1 评论0

C语言中的累加之美,从基础到应用

C语言,作为一门历史悠久且广泛应用的编程语言,以其简洁、高效、灵活的特点受到了全球程序员的喜爱。在C语言的世界里,累加是一种基础的...

排名链接 2024-12-28 阅读1 评论0

蒙面IT侠群,科技战疫背后的英雄身影

自2020年以来,一场突如其来的新冠疫情席卷全球,给人类社会带来了前所未有的挑战。在这场没有硝烟的战争中,无数英雄英勇无畏地冲锋在...

排名链接 2024-12-28 阅读1 评论0